Output 58aec9ab7a2ea90de60ef5ee13a7f19d45c7deea52f5ec77a20cc8d10813ba3d:3

value
3148185
script pubkey
OP_0 OP_PUSHBYTES_32 e5df2004644ab29b17703ed34fa9c778e404cbb7d9e8559b755561b2b6087bde
address
bc1quh0jqpryf2efk9ms8mf5l2w80rjqfjahm859txm424sm9dsg000qtty34r
transaction
58aec9ab7a2ea90de60ef5ee13a7f19d45c7deea52f5ec77a20cc8d10813ba3d
confirmations
22286
spent
true